JavaScript数组前面插入元素的方法


Posted in Javascript onApril 06, 2015

本文实例讲述了JavaScript数组前面插入元素的方法。分享给大家供大家参考。具体如下:

JS数组带有一个unshift方法可以再数组前面添加若干个元素,下面是详细的代码演示

<!DOCTYPE html>

<html>

<body>

<p id="demo">Click the button to add elements to the array.</p>

<button onclick="myFunction()">Try it</button>

<script>

function myFunction()

{

var fruits = ["Banana", "Orange", "Apple", "Mango"];

fruits.unshift("Lemon","Pineapple");

var x=document.getElementById("demo");

x.innerHTML=fruits;

}

</script>

<p><b>Note:</b> The unshift() method does not work properly in Internet Explorer 8 and earlier, the values will be inserted, but the return value will be <em>undefined</em>.</p>

</body>

</html>

执行后数组会变成下面的样子

Lemon,Pineapple,Banana,Orange,Apple,Mango

unshift在ie8及之前的版本工作有些问题,数组会插入元素,但是返回值是undefined

希望本文所述对大家的javascript程序设计有所帮助。

Javascript 相关文章推荐
javascript 事件处理、鼠标拖动效果实现方法详解
May 11 Javascript
JS去除字符串两端空格的简单实例
Dec 27 Javascript
javascript自定义函数参数传递为字符串格式
Jul 29 Javascript
node.js中的Socket.IO使用实例
Nov 04 Javascript
js实现新年倒计时效果
Dec 10 Javascript
理解javascript中的MVC模式
Jan 28 Javascript
JS组件Bootstrap Table布局详解
May 27 Javascript
jQuery动态创建元素以及追加节点的实现方法
Oct 20 Javascript
React组件的三种写法总结
Jan 12 Javascript
axios学习教程全攻略
Mar 26 Javascript
jQuery实现为table表格动态添加或删除tr功能示例
Feb 19 jQuery
Webpack4+Babel7+ES6兼容IE8的实现
Apr 10 Javascript
JavaScript里四舍五入函数round用法实例
Apr 06 #Javascript
JavaScript返回0-1之间随机数的方法
Apr 06 #Javascript
JavaScript使用Max函数返回两个数字中较大数的方法
Apr 06 #Javascript
JavaScript使用Math.Min返回两个数中较小数的方法
Apr 06 #Javascript
JavaScript弹出新窗口后向父窗口输出内容的方法
Apr 06 #Javascript
JavaScript弹出新窗口并控制窗口移动到指定位置的方法
Apr 06 #Javascript
JavaScript动态修改弹出窗口大小的方法
Apr 06 #Javascript
You might like
德劲1104的电路分析与改良
2021/03/01 无线电
PHP与MySQL交互使用详解
2006/10/09 PHP
js Select下拉列表框进行多选、移除、交换内容的具体实现方法
2013/08/13 Javascript
JQuery异步获取返回值中文乱码的解决方法
2015/01/29 Javascript
解析javascript图片懒加载与预加载的分析总结
2016/10/27 Javascript
JavaScript中undefined和null的区别
2017/05/03 Javascript
关于vue的语法规则检测报错问题的解决
2018/05/21 Javascript
JS实现DOM节点插入操作之子节点与兄弟节点插入操作示例
2018/07/30 Javascript
通过实例了解js函数中参数的传递
2019/06/15 Javascript
微信小程序实现单个卡片左滑显示按钮并防止上下滑动干扰功能
2019/12/06 Javascript
koa-passport实现本地验证的方法示例
2020/02/20 Javascript
Python格式化日期时间操作示例
2018/06/28 Python
Anaconda下配置python+opencv+contribx的实例讲解
2018/08/06 Python
Python学习笔记之列表推导式实例分析
2019/08/13 Python
使用PyTorch训练一个图像分类器实例
2020/01/08 Python
python实现图片素描效果
2020/09/26 Python
用python对oracle进行简单性能测试
2020/12/05 Python
css3中transition属性详解
2014/09/02 HTML / CSS
HTML5中的Scoped属性使用实例
2014/04/23 HTML / CSS
米兰网婚纱礼服法国网上商店:Milanoo法国
2016/08/20 全球购物
Theflamel意大利:女士奢华服装、鞋子和配件
2020/01/11 全球购物
介绍一下gcc特性
2015/10/31 面试题
装潢设计专业推荐信模板
2013/11/26 职场文书
员工培训心得体会
2013/12/30 职场文书
创业计划书的内容步骤和要领
2014/01/04 职场文书
企业安全生产承诺书
2014/05/22 职场文书
排查整治工作方案
2014/06/09 职场文书
小学竞选班长演讲稿
2014/09/09 职场文书
万里长城导游词
2015/01/30 职场文书
2015年禁毒宣传活动总结
2015/03/25 职场文书
医药公司开票员岗位职责
2015/04/15 职场文书
员工辞职信范文大全
2015/05/12 职场文书
放飞理想主题班会
2015/08/14 职场文书
关于做家务的心得体会
2016/01/23 职场文书
Redis+AOP+自定义注解实现限流
2022/06/28 Redis
使用CSS实现百叶窗效果示例代码
2023/05/07 HTML / CSS